2011-04-04 29 views
2

我已經創建了一個簡單的程序,在C中打印「Hello world」1000次。現在我想測試非常睏倦的分析器,但是它不會在進程間看到正在運行的程序。 我在調試模式下運行應用程序,visual studio 2010.是否有任何非常困惑的profiler教程?

+1

很困問題 – 2011-04-04 06:48:51

+0

它會採取你同樣的時間來寫至少暗示 – pojo 2011-04-04 06:52:38

+0

它是在幽默中的一個失敗的嘗試。 :( – 2011-04-04 06:58:05

回答

0

我建議你使用process explorer。在啓動程序之前啓動它,你會看到它出現在列表中,並且通過屬性知道它的標識符,如果你願意,還可以知道它的線程。

因此,當您發起睏倦時,您會準確地找到您正在查找的PID和TID。

2

如果你使用Vista或Windows 7,您可能需要運行很困作爲管理員,因此它可以看到(和清單)的過程。

2

另外,您也可以先啓動分析器,然後通過文件/啓動運行您的程序......

無恥插頭:您可以使用「很困」的修改後的版本,它允許您啓動分析目標W /剖析暫停,並用了一個API,允許您啓動/停止剖析編程這裏:http://hoffesommer.com/weblog/2011/06/17/very-sleepy-0_7_2-cpp-profiler-now-with-api/

+0

不再是,顯然 – Kaitain 2016-05-13 16:01:24

+0

這是mhoffesommer的fork [回購GitHub](https: //github.com/mhoffesommer/Very-Sleepy)從原來的博客文章(因爲博客不再公開可訪問)。 – SleuthEye 2018-02-13 13:32:01

相關問題